Program Overview:
Virtually every workplace exposes its employees to some type of chemical. For some, working with chemicals is
a vital part of their job. As an employer, its your responsibility to help your employees understand what materials
are being used, how to use them safely, and what to do if an emergency occurs. One of our best sellers, this program
will teach your employees the essentials of working with chemicals.
Your Employees Will Learn:
- How to Evaluate Warning Labels
- How to Read a Material Safety Data Sheet
- Hazard Classification System, Including the FACTOR System (Flammable and Corrosive, Toxic, or Reactive)
- Precautionary Measures, Including Information on the use of Personal Protective Equipment
- Routes of Chemical Entry into the Body
- Proper Storage of Chemicals
- Emergency Procedures
